Even looks from Vanity Fair's Oscars after party would work for this imaginary trip — specifically, Barbie Ferreira's striped, strapless Fendi dress, which is from the brand's Spring 2022 collection.
According to Christopher Horan, Ferreira's stylist, the two have actually been waiting for the perfect moment for the Euphoria actress to wear this piece.
"Barbie has loved this look from the moment she saw the collection," he told InStyle via email. "She and I send tons of texts back and forth, and she knew right away. I think we first pinned this look in early December as an option for a super special event."
RELATED: Laverne Cox's Custom-Made 2022 Oscars Dress Brought Designer August Getty to Tears
And those the vacation vibes we were getting? Well, it seems we weren't totally off.
"She loved the colors and just coming back from Brazil, she felt the timing was perfect," Horan said. "The colors and her tan skin felt like a spring kick off."
Ferreira's slicked-back ponytail and bronzed makeup seemed to match that same vacation energy and our eyes were also locked on her coordinating sandals and accessories, which helped to enhance her ensemble.
"She loves doing a colorful shoe — colorful everything, honestly," Horan told us before touching on those geometric bracelets. "We also loved the idea of gold jewelry and interesting shapes. Barbie really loved the idea of an arm cuff with this look."
Horan added that the "flowy angelic" look was somewhat new for Ferreira, and that the main goal for his clients has been to lean into the sexy — which we feel was definitely achieved here.
"I think the biggest aesthetic trend I've noticed throughout all my clients and friends is the wanting to just be kind of hot," he said. "I think after the first lockdown, everyone kind of emerged wanting to feel sexy, and I think you can see it in all the collections currently, too."

Barbie Ferreira is among the most colorful dressers in young Hollywood, and she proved the point at the Vanity Fair Oscars afterparty on Sunday, March 27, when she arrived in a silk Fendi scarf dress infused with '70s glamour. The "Euphoria" actor, who works with stylist Chris Horan on everything from editorials to events, plucked this design straight off Kim Jones's spring/summer 2022 runway, where an archival logo was revamped. The subtle yet striking "Fendi" pattern was imprinted across Ferreira's strapless dress, which was composed of diagonal ivory, pink, and gold stripes from top to bottom.
